A vocabulary for the catalysis disciplines
github.com/nfdi4cat/voc4catVoc4Cat is a [SKOS](https://www.w3.org/TR/2009/REC-skos-reference-20090818/) vocabulary for the catalysis disciplines. The vocabulary was created in the [NFDI4Cat](http://www.nfdi4cat.org/) initiative. The first collection of terms was published in June 2023 with a focus on photo catalysis. Our goal is to continuously extend the vocabulary to other areas of catalysis and related disciplines like chemical engineering or materials science.
